London Office Renting FAQs

What is the average price of offices for rent in London?

With London being a popular business location, the prices of private offices can vary greatly depending on the size, location and features of the space. A monthly private office in the outskirts of London can average around £200 monthly per person whereas prime Central London office space can start from £900 per person per month.

 

What types of office space can you rent in London?

London offers a vast range of flexible office space from private offices for smaller companies to self-contained floors with bespoke branding for well-established large businesses. Hot-desking and co-working are also cost-friendly options for companies looking for office space with all the benefits of a city-centre location.

 

What areas in London are popular for offices?

Each of the 30 plus London boroughs have gained their own personality. The creative borough of Hackney is popular with technology start-ups whereas areas like Liverpool Street are a suitable choice for financial companies. Covent Garden is also one of the areas most famed for its street theatres and boutiques, making it popular with businesses in the media industry.

 

How do you commute in London?

The London Underground, reaching from the centre of town to the outskirts is the most popular form of transport for commuters living inside and outside the capital. With buses and rail links to major stations and airports, offices are easily accessible both nationally and internationally.
